How much do remote library j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ote library in Boston, MA is $79,289.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$61,900.00 and $92,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Remote Library position, and why are they important?

To excel as a Remote Librarian, you need a solid background in library science, information management, and research methods, often supported by a master's degree in library or information science. Familiarity with digital cataloging systems, online databases, and remote collaboration tools is typically required. Strong communication, self-motivation, and organizational skills help professionals effectively support users and manage resources virtually. These competencies are essential for providing high-quality library services and maintaining efficient access to information in a digital, remote environment.

What is a Remote Library job?

A Remote Library job involves providing library services and support in a virtual or online environment. Responsibilities may include cataloging digital resources, assisting patrons with research, managing databases, and facilitating virtual programs. These roles are typically performed from home or another remote location using digital tools and communication platforms. Remote librarians and library staff help users access information efficiently without needing to visit a physical library.

What does a typical day look like for a Remote Librarian?

A typical day for a Remote Librarian involves assisting patrons with research requests via email or chat, managing digital collections, updating online catalogs, and collaborating with academic staff or library teams through video meetings. You may also provide virtual instruction on information literacy or database usage, troubleshoot access issues, and curate digital resources relevant to users' needs. While the work is primarily independent, regular communication with colleagues and library users is common. The role offers flexibility but requires proactive time management and comfort with digital communication platforms.

Job description

Northstar Fertility Partners (www.nsfertility.com) is an industry leader in fertility services, specializing in surrogacy, egg donation, and family building through a constellation of expert-led companies. We have helped bring over 11.500 babies into the world through our services. We are looking for a talented and motivated Designer to join our team. In this role, you will support a wide range of creative and digital projects — from designing and building paid media landing pages in Wix, to producing digital ad creative, updating web pages and marketing collateral, and creating Figma mockups. If you have a strong eye for design, a passion for craft, and thrive in a fast-moving environment, this role would be a great fit for you.

As Northstar’s Designer, you will be responsible for a variety of digital and print design tasks across our Northstar brands. This includes designing and developing paid media landing pages in Wix, creating digital ad assets, updating existing Wix websites, creating new marketing collateral as well as editing existing material, and building Figma wireframes and mockups for review. You will craft visually compelling work that balances strong aesthetic design including imagery, typography, and layout, with a strategic focus on clear communication and brand consistency.

What you’ll do:

  • Design and build conversion-focused paid landing pages within Wix.
  • Update and maintain existing Wix website pages, including content updates, layout adjustments, and other requested modifications.
  • Develop digital ad creative (static and animated) for paid media campaigns across Google, Meta, and other platforms.
  • Update and create marketing collateral (brochures, one-pagers, guides, etc.) in accordance with brand guidelines.
  • Create Figma wireframes and design mockups for website pages and landing pages for team review and approval.
  • Maintain consistency with provided brand guidelines and approved asset libraries across all deliverables.

What you’ll need to succeed:

  • High school diploma or equivalent.
  • 3-5 years of previous graphic design experience.
  • Hands-on experience building and editing pages within Wix. This is a must.
  • A portfolio demonstrating a range of design work including digital ads, website design, and/or print collateral.
  • Proficiency in Figma for wireframing and design mockups.
  • Experience designing digital ad creative (static banners, social ads) for paid media campaigns.
  • Ability to work across multiple brands simultaneously while maintaining distinct brand identities.
  • Proficient in Adobe Creative Suite (Illustrator, InDesign, Photoshop, Adobe Acrobat) as well as Canva.
  • Detail-oriented, self-sufficient, able to meet deadlines with minimal oversight, and receptive to feedback and creative direction.
  • Maintain organized file and asset libraries across shared drives and Figma to ensure team-wide accessibility and version control.
  • Clear communicator who can present work, participate in feedback rounds, and interpret creative direction effectively.
  • Willingness to learn and adapt to new platforms and tools as our tech stack evolves.

What’s nice to have:

  • Experience with Asana.
  • Familiarity with A/B testing principles and landing page optimization strategies.
  • Knowledge of UX/UI best practices and basic understanding of SEO principles.
  • Experience working within a fast-paced, multi-brand or agency environment.
  • Familiarity with AI design tools such as Adobe Firefly, Midjourney, or similar.
  • Basic awareness of HTML/CSS, particularly as it relates to working within Wix and collaborating with developers.
  • Basic video editing or motion asset resizing experience (e.g., Reels, stories, paid video formats) using tools such as Canva, CapCut, or Adobe Premiere.
